Differences concerning FDM, SLS, SLA, PolyJet, and MJF techniques within just 3d printing expert services
Navigating the landscape of 3d printing companies reveals distinct distinctions amongst well-known printing techniques like FDM, SLS, SLA, PolyJet, and MJF, Each and every favored by 3d printing manufacturers for unique applications. FDM excels in making tough elements with comparatively easy geometry, which makes it a go-to for fast evidence-of-concept versions. In contrast, SLS utilizes a powder mattress fusion strategy, building sophisticated geometries without having assist buildings and presenting bigger mechanical strength appropriate for useful testing. SLA is appreciated for its remarkably sleek area complete and high resolution, lending itself nicely to specific visual prototypes and intricate layouts. PolyJet technology pushes the boundary additional by combining multiple supplies and colors in an individual print, ideal for real looking multimaterial prototypes, even though MJF stands out with its rapidly Establish periods and fantastic depth, suited to creating conclude-use components and swift iterations. tailor made 3d printing companies leverage these technologies according to challenge plans, ensuring that substance Homes, element precision, and output velocity align with consumer requires. choosing the right 3d printing prototype service for substance and finish specifications
Material option and surface end can drastically impression the utility and presentation of the prototype, guiding the choice of a custom 3d printing assistance. Different industries call for various attributes, including overall flexibility, heat resistance, or transparency, which 3d printing brands accommodate by featuring A selection of polymers, resins, and various components throughout their platforms. By way of example, engineering prototypes aimed toward mechanical screening could prioritize tough nylons or strengthened composites, generally accessed via SLS or MJF systems. In distinction, SLA and PolyJet printing deliver fantastic area finishes that cut down submit-processing and provide properly for aesthetic products needing clean textures or shade blends. the chance to cope with modest batch runs of prototypes although preserving constant content top quality also plays an important job in picking out the correct 3d printing prototype provider. influence of layer resolution and precision on 3d industrial printing outcomes
The diploma of layer resolution and precision immediately influences the functional fidelity and visual charm of prototypes made by custom 3d printing expert services. increased layer resolution, with increments as good as twenty five micrometers, facilitates the generation of complex information and easy surfaces vital for healthy, variety, and assembly testing. This volume of precision is vital when establishing components for aerospace or health care programs, the place dimensional accuracy impacts effectiveness and compliance. 3d printing makers integrating Superior additive production systems give attention to managing these parameters to provide constant and responsible parts, enabling engineers to trust prototypes for iterative structure validation.
